Transaction ecbb04a973c1833997993546b87bd7f5e684330786028ee1d651c692417c277f
1 Input
1 Output
-
ecbb04a973c1833997993546b87bd7f5e684330786028ee1d651c692417c277f:0
- value
- 14595285
- script pubkey
- OP_0 OP_PUSHBYTES_20 caea8f45b876cdd6f0f98f31b1bb289fdb832e12
- address
- bc1qet4g73dcwmxadu8e3ucmrwegnldcxtsj0wkgje